{"data":{"id":"us-nv/nrs-701b.321","jurisdiction":"us-nv","citation":"NRS 701B.321","heading":"“Public and other property” defined.","body":"1. “Public and other property” means any real property, building or facility which is owned, leased or occupied by:\n(a) A public entity;\n(b) A nonprofit organization that is recognized as exempt from taxation pursuant to section 501(c)(3) of the Internal Revenue Code, 26 U.S.C. § 501(c)(3), as amended; or\n(c) A corporation for public benefit as defined in NRS 82.021.\n2. The term includes, without limitation, any real property, building or facility which is owned, leased or occupied by:\n(a) A church; or\n(b) A benevolent, fraternal or charitable lodge, society or organization.\n3. The term does not include school property.","path":["TITLE 58 — ENERGY; PUBLIC UTILITIES AND SIMILAR ENTITIES","CHAPTER 701B - RENEWABLE ENERGY PROGRAMS","SOLAR THERMAL SYSTEMS DEMONSTRATION PROGRAM","General Provisions"],"source_url":"https://www.leg.state.nv.us/NRS/NRS-701B.html#NRS701BSec321","current_through":"2025 session (NRS as revised 2026-08-25)","vintage":"","retrieved_at":"2026-09-03T05:51:47Z","sha256":"2c2d355967a637c35808974a350fc270766d3ec81b57697f740eb9eda262c783","source_id":"us-nv","stale":true,"prev":"us-nv/nrs-701b.318","next":"us-nv/nrs-701b.324"},"notice":"GroundRules: Original legal text.
